Landfills in Barnstable County, Massachusetts

There are 5 Landfills in Barnstable County, Massachusetts, serving a population of 213,900 people in an area of 394 square miles. There is 1 Landfill per 42,780 people, and 1 Landfill per 78 square miles.

In Massachusetts, Barnstable County is ranked 3rd of 14 counties in Landfills per capita, and 2nd of 14 counties in Landfills per square mile.

About Barnstable County Landfills

Landfills in Barnstable County, MA are solid waste disposal facilities that bury trash underneath layers of soil. The United States Environmental Protection Agency and Massachusetts Environmental Agencies regulate and license Barnstable County garbage dumps, sanitary landfills, and dump sites. The design, operation, and allowable waste are dictated by Massachusetts law.
